    After NGF deprivation, prodegenerative transcription is upregulated. Axoplasmic calcium is increased and enriched in spheroids prior to catastrophic phase. Spheroid formation is regulated by p75NTR, Rho activity, and caspase activation. The calcium electrochemical gradient across the membrane is disrupted by spheroidal rupture, which may also lead to the release of intra-axonal prodegenerative molecules to extracellular space, acting as extrinsic factors to promote degeneration in a paracrine or autocrine manner. We speculate that p75NTR plays important role in calcium dynamics during the latent phase, while DR6 can be activated by prodegenerative NDCM to mediate downstream catastrophic degeneration pathways (e.g. DLK/JNK, calpastatin, calpain).

    a Schematic representation of the pathways that control axonal degeneration. Key activators of each pathway, as well as other downstream contributors to the pathways are depicted. Pharmacological treatments used in the experiments are marked in purple. b-d DRG explants of WT ( b ), Bax -/- ( c ) and Sarm1 -/- ( d ) embryos were cultured for 48 to 96 h in the presence of NGF before axon degeneration was initiated by NGF deprivation, 40 nM vincristine, or axotomy, with addition of flag MFG-E8 D89E , for additional 16 h (Axotomy) or 24 h (NGF deprivation and Vincristine). After treatment, cells were briefly fixed, stained with anti-Flag, and PS exposure was measured by anti-Flag staining intensity. WT axons expose PS after all treatments, while Bax null axons expose PS after vincristine and axotomy, but not after NGF deprivation. Sarm1 null axons expose PS after NGF deprivation but not after vincristine or axotomy. e Quantification of PS exposure levels on WT, Bax -/- and Sarm1 -/- axons in all treatments. Error bars mean ± SEM, p -value, compare with WT exposure levels (student t test): *** P < 0.001. Scale bar: 50 μm, N = minimum of five separate explants were analyzed per experimental condition

    a DRG axons were cultured for 48 h in the presence of NGF before supplementation with 20 mM NAD + or vehicle control and an additional 24 h of culture, with addition of flag MFG-E8 D89E . After treatment, cells were briefly fixed, stained with anti-Flag, and PS exposure was measured by anti-Flag staining intensity. NAD + had no effect on basal PS exposure levels. b , c DRG axons were cultured for 48 h and then NGF-deprived for 8, 16, or 24 h with vehicle control or 20 mM NAD + supplement. PS exposure was reduced significantly after 16 h in the NAD + treated axons, but not at 24 h. d , e DRG axons were cultured for 96 h before treatment with 40 nM vincristine with vehicle or 120 mM NAD + supplement for 8, 16, or 24 h. PS exposure was reduced significantly after 16 h and 24 h. f , g DRG axons were cultured for 48 h before axons were axotomized using sharp needle, and cultured with vehicle or 20 mM NAD + supplement for 4, 8, or 16 h. NAD + supplement prevented PS exposure on axotomized axons in all tested times. h ATP levels with or without NAD + supplement. DRG explants were cultured on cell inserts for 48 h before treated with NGF deprivation, vincristine or axotomy. After indicated time points, axonal compartment were collected and ATP levels were quantified. All three treatments significantly reduced axonal ATP levels, compare with control. NAD + supplement prevented ATP reduction and rescued axonal ATP levels back to control levels. i DRG axons were cultured for 48 h and then treated with 10 μM FK866 or DMSO for 5, 10 and 24 h. PS exposure was not affected by FK866 treatment at all time point tested. j Quntification of PS exspoure levels after FK866 or DMSO treatment. Error bars indicate mean ± SEM, p -value (two-way ANOVA): * P < 0.05, ** P < 0.01, *** P < 0.001 (In H all p -values are compared to vehicle control). Scale bar: 100 μm, N = minimum of five separate explants were analyzed per experimental condition
